Global Aluminum Hydroxide Market (USD Million), 2021 - 2031
In the year 2024, the Global Aluminum Hydroxide Market was valued at USD 2,044.45 million.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 2,848.10 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.9%.
The global aluminum hydroxide market is a critical segment within the broader chemicals and materials industry, driven by its extensive applications across various sectors. Aluminum hydroxide, also known as alumina trihydrate, is primarily used as a flame retardant and filler material in industries such as plastics, rubber, ceramics, and pharmaceuticals. Its ability to release water vapor when exposed to high temperatures makes it effective in suppressing flames and preventing the spread of fires, making it essential in fire-resistant coatings, cables, and textiles.
In addition to its role as a flame retardant, aluminum hydroxide is widely utilized in the production of aluminum chemicals and as a feedstock for manufacturing aluminum metal. It serves as a key raw material in the synthesis of aluminum oxide, which is crucial in the production of ceramics, catalysts, and abrasives. The pharmaceutical industry also relies on aluminum hydroxide for its antacid properties, where it is used to neutralize excess stomach acid and treat conditions such as heartburn and indigestion.
The demand for aluminum hydroxide is influenced by industrialization trends, regulatory standards, and economic factors across regions like North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America, and the Middle East and Africa. As industries continue to prioritize safety, efficiency, and sustainability, the global aluminum hydroxide market is poised for steady growth, driven by its versatile applications and essential role in various industrial processes and consumer products.

Segment Analysis
The Global Aluminum Hydroxide Market is segmented by Grade, Form, Application, and Geography.
By Grade, the market is typically divided into Industrial Grade and Pharmaceutical Grade. Industrial grade aluminum hydroxide is primarily used in applications such as flame retardants, water treatment, and as a filler in plastics and rubbers. It is also widely used in the production of aluminum metal and chemicals. Pharmaceutical grade aluminum hydroxide is a high-purity form used in medical and healthcare products, such as antacids and vaccines, where safety and purity are crucial. This segment has seen consistent demand, driven by the growing healthcare sector, particularly in emerging economies.
By Form, the aluminum hydroxide market is categorized into Powder, Granules, and Others. Powdered aluminum hydroxide is the most widely used form due to its versatility and ease of handling in various industrial processes. Granular aluminum hydroxide is used when a controlled particle size is required, such as in flame retardant applications and water purification. The Others segment includes forms such as suspensions or slurries, which are used in specific applications where liquid or semi-solid forms are more appropriate, including certain chemical processes and treatments.
By Application, aluminum hydroxide is used across various industries, with significant demand from the Flame Retardants industry, Water Treatment, Aluminum Production, and Pharmaceuticals. The Flame Retardants segment is a key driver due to aluminum hydroxide’s ability to release water when heated, helping to extinguish flames and prevent further spread. In Water Treatment, it is used as a coagulant to remove impurities and particles. In Aluminum Production, it is an intermediate compound in the Bayer process, where it is used to extract alumina from bauxite. The Pharmaceuticals segment uses aluminum hydroxide for antacid formulations and other health-related applications.

Global Aluminum Hydroxide Market, Segmentation by Grade
The Global Aluminum Hydroxide Market has been segmented by Grade into Industrial Grade and Pharmaceutical Grade.
Industrial grade aluminum hydroxide is predominantly used in industries such as plastics, rubber, ceramics, and chemicals. As a flame retardant, industrial grade aluminum hydroxide plays a crucial role in enhancing the fire resistance of various products, including cables, textiles, and construction materials. Its ability to release water vapor when exposed to high temperatures effectively suppresses flames, making it a preferred choice in industries where fire safety is paramount. Additionally, in plastics and rubber manufacturing, industrial grade aluminum hydroxide serves as a filler material, improving mechanical properties such as strength, stiffness, and thermal stability. Its cost-effectiveness and versatility further contribute to its widespread adoption across these industrial sectors.
Pharmaceutical grade aluminum hydroxide is characterized by its high purity and stringent quality standards necessary for pharmaceutical applications. It is primarily utilized as an active ingredient in antacid formulations, where it acts as a neutralizer of stomach acid to relieve symptoms of acid-related gastrointestinal disorders like heartburn and indigestion. Pharmaceutical grade aluminum hydroxide is favored for its safety profile and efficacy in providing long-lasting relief from gastric discomfort. Its inert nature ensures compatibility with other pharmaceutical ingredients, making it a reliable choice in the production of over-the-counter and prescription antacid medications.

Raw Material Costs : Raw material costs play a crucial role in the dynamics of the global aluminum hydroxide market, significantly influencing production expenses and overall market competitiveness. Aluminum hydroxide production primarily relies on bauxite as its main raw material. The availability and pricing of bauxite, which is influenced by factors such as mining regulations, geopolitical stability, and supply chain logistics, directly impact the cost structure of aluminum hydroxide manufacturers. Fluctuations in bauxite prices can lead to variability in aluminum hydroxide production costs, subsequently affecting market prices and profit margins for producers.
Energy costs are another vital component in the production of aluminum hydroxide. The extraction and processing of bauxite into aluminum hydroxide are energy-intensive processes, requiring substantial electricity and fuel. Variations in global energy prices, driven by factors such as oil market dynamics, regional energy policies, and shifts in energy supply and demand, can significantly influence production costs. High energy costs can increase overall production expenses, posing challenges for manufacturers to maintain competitive pricing while ensuring profitability.
Transportation and logistical expenses associated with the procurement and distribution of raw materials impact the global aluminum hydroxide market. Efficient supply chain management is essential to minimize costs related to the transportation of bauxite and other raw materials to production facilities and the distribution of finished products to end-users. Disruptions in logistics, such as delays in shipping, increased freight costs, or changes in trade policies, can escalate raw material costs, thereby affecting the pricing and availability of aluminum hydroxide in the market. Manufacturers need to strategically manage their supply chains to mitigate these risks and ensure a steady supply of raw materials at optimal costs.

Advanced Ceramics : The global aluminum hydroxide market plays a crucial role in the production of advanced ceramics, a segment characterized by its high-performance materials used in various demanding applications. Aluminum hydroxide is a key precursor in the synthesis of aluminum oxide (alumina), which is a fundamental component in advanced ceramics. These ceramics are valued for their exceptional properties, including high thermal stability, mechanical strength, wear resistance, and electrical insulation, making them indispensable in industries such as electronics, automotive, aerospace, and medical devices.
In the electronics industry, advanced ceramics made from alumina are used to manufacture substrates, insulators, and various components that require high precision and reliability. The material's excellent electrical insulation and thermal conductivity properties make it ideal for use in semiconductors, capacitors, and other electronic devices. Similarly, in the automotive and aerospace sectors, alumina-based ceramics are utilized for their ability to withstand extreme temperatures and harsh operating conditions, enhancing the performance and durability of engine components, sensors, and other critical parts.
The medical industry leverages advanced ceramics for applications such as prosthetics, dental implants, and surgical instruments, where biocompatibility and mechanical strength are paramount. The superior wear resistance and chemical inertness of alumina ceramics contribute to their longevity and reliability in medical applications.
